[PATCH 3/3] staging: comedi: 8253.h: use usual style for single-line comments

From: Ian Abbott
Date: Mon Jan 26 2015 - 07:06:48 EST


Use one space after the opening and one space before the closing of the
comment.

Signed-off-by: Ian Abbott <abbotti@xxxxxxxxx>
---
drivers/staging/comedi/drivers/8253.h | 48 +++++++++++++++++------------------
1 file changed, 24 insertions(+), 24 deletions(-)

diff --git a/drivers/staging/comedi/drivers/8253.h b/drivers/staging/comedi/drivers/8253.h
index 0d9aec0..51b9c8d 100644
--- a/drivers/staging/comedi/drivers/8253.h
+++ b/drivers/staging/comedi/drivers/8253.h
@@ -116,7 +116,7 @@ static inline void i8253_cascade_ns_to_timer(int i8253_osc_base,
}

*nanosec = div1 * div2 * i8253_osc_base;
- /* masking is done since counter maps zero to 0x10000 */
+ /* masking is done since counter maps zero to 0x10000 */
*d1 = div1 & 0xffff;
*d2 = div2 & 0xffff;
}
